The Indian Telugu Association of Ghana warmly invites you and your family to celebrate Ugadi 2026, the Telugu New Year—a festival that marks renewal, prosperity, and the beginning of a new chapter filled with hope and positivity.
Ugadi is a time-honored tradition symbolizing fresh starts and gratitude. Rooted in rich cultural heritage, the celebration brings together rituals, festive cuisine, and community bonding—creating an atmosphere of joy and spiritual reflection.
